    Introduction

    Heralded as one the NBA’s most exciting young players, Blake Griffin has transcended the game of basketball and has accomplished more in his rookie season than what an average NBA player achieves in a career. These are no exaggerations or even stretching the truth. Blake Griffin has already proved that he is something more than average.

    No matter how easy he makes it look, and he often makes it look effortless, Blake’s ability did not just magically come together overnight. Blake’s parents, Tommy and Gail, instilled the value of hard work in their sons Blake and older brother Taylor from childhood when they were home-schooled as youngsters until high school. Tommy started with Blake as a toddler, working out with him and teaching him how to shoot baskets in the gym.

    After Taylor moved on to play basketball for Oklahoma, Blake gained invaluable experience playing pickup games against his brother’s college teammates. The result? State championships in his junior and senior years, making Blake a state champion in all four years of high school, an incredibly rare feat. Following his junior season, Blake declined scholarships to national powerhouses such as Duke and Kansas, opting instead to join his brother at Oklahoma University. In his second year at Oklahoma, Blake posted one of the most dominant seasons ever by a collegiate player and became a household name for his tremendous flair and ferocious slam-dunks. While leading Oklahoma to the Sweet 16, Griffin was rewarded for his outstanding play by being chosen as the Naismith, Wooden and Associated Press Player of the Year en route to being a consensus selection as National Player of the Year. Following a run where Blake lead the Oklahoma Sooners to the Sweet 16, Blake announced that he would enter the 2009 NBA Draft.

    Known as the Blake Griffin Sweepstakes, the Los Angeles Clippers, equipped with only a 17.7 percent chance of winning the rights of the number one overall pick in the 2009 NBA Draft, were revealed as the team that would have the rights to the first overall draft pick. Blake Griffin was so highly touted, where in a system where team’s work out potential draft picks for several weeks before making their choice on who to select, the Clippers were so confident that they would select Blake Griffin that Clippers team president Andy Roeser, who was representing the team at the time of the drawing, actually wore a pattern designed as the Clippers’ home jersey. Inside his sport-jacket was the number 1 emblazoned on one side, and the number 23, Blake’s college jersey number, sewn on the other. On June 25, 2009, the Los Angeles Clippers selected Blake Griffin as the number one overall pick.

    Blake began the 2009 NBA pre-season with a bang, racking up big numbers and even bigger highlight dunks. In the final pre-season game before his long awaited NBA debut, disaster struck as Blake suffered a knee injury that would cost him his rookie season. Blake spent the year with the team in his street clothes and his Dora the Explorer book bag. Blake, however, was not to be denied. After a year of grueling rehab and intense training, Blake finally launched his rookie campaign on October 27th, 2010 against the Portland Trail Blazers with a 20 point, 14 rebound performance.
